What is the purpose of anointing your home?

The anointing oil is a symbol of faith in the power of the Holy Spirit and God’s ability to defend, purify, and protect against evil. It casts out unwelcome evil spirits. Anointing a house with oil is also a way to consecrate it to God.

What kind of oil was used for anointing in the Bible?

The biblical anointing oil was usually made from olive oil, which was abundant in ancient Israel.

How do Christians do house warming?

In Roman Catholic, Lutheran, Anglican, Methodist, and Orthodox traditions, the pastor usually sprinkles holy water (depending on the denominational tradition) and walks through every room of the house with the occupants, praying For the occupants.

What does Shalom mean in the Bible?

Shalom (Hebrew: שکׁלוډם šālōm, also spelled sholom, sholem, sholoim, shulem) means peace, harmony, wholeness, completeness, prosperity, It is a Hebrew word meaning peace, harmony, wholeness, integrity, prosperity, welfare, and tranquility, and can be used as an idiom to mean both hello and good-bye.
